Why Nigerians Need Better Flight-Saving Strategies
Flight costs often increase due to:
- Currency fluctuations
- Seasonality and holidays
- High demand on popular routes
- Limited airline options for certain destinations
But the good news is: you can still save a lot by knowing when, how, and where to book.

2. Book Early—But Not Too Early
For Nigerian travelers, the best booking window is usually:
- 2–6 weeks for local and regional flights
- 6–12 weeks for international travel
Booking too early may show higher fares, while last-minute tickets are almost always expensive.

3. Fly on Cheaper Travel Days
Some days naturally cost less due to lower demand.
Best days to fly:
- Tuesday
- Wednesday
- Saturday
Avoid busy days like Fridays and Sundays, where prices spike because of weekend travel.
4. Be Flexible With Dates and Times
A one-day or one-hour change can save you tens of thousands of Naira.
Try flying during:
- Very early mornings
- Mid-week
- Off-peak travel seasons

5. Avoid Peak Travel Seasons When Possible
Flight prices skyrocket during:
- Christmas
- Easter
- Summer holidays
- Festival periods
- Long weekends
If you must travel during peak periods, book as early as possible (minimum 6–10 weeks ahead).
6. Choose One-Way Flights When They’re Cheaper
Some routes are surprisingly cheaper when split into two one-way tickets rather than a round-trip bundle.

7. Consider Nearby Airports
For international flights, sometimes flying out from:
- Lagos instead of Abuja
- Accra instead of Lagos
- Kigali instead of Nairobi
…can save you a lot.
